This role involves assisting in the nursing care of mentally ill patients by implementing various types of psychiatric treatment plans for groups of patients, including group interventions. The position requires delivering health care services to patients and their families according to the interdisciplinary treatment plan, and independently implementing this plan for an assigned group of patients. The technician will revise and modify the plan in response to changes in patient condition and therapeutic approach, and participate in planning conferences. Integration of multidisciplinary approaches to complete patient assessments and coordinate health care services across the continuum is essential. The role also involves demonstrating problem-solving and critical-thinking skills in developing health care interventions, participating in therapeutic activities, and collaborating with patients, family members, and the interdisciplinary treatment team. Additionally, the position requires participation in ongoing staff development programs, workshops, and seminars, as well as implementing orientation and training for peer staff, including new Psychiatric Technicians. Involvement in unit-based research and quality improvement, including data collection and documentation, is also part of the responsibilities.
